Job description
Overview

Northern Gateway Public Schools invites applications for a Temporary Part-time Teaching position (0.5 FTE) at Whitecourt Central School.

Responsibilities
  • Teaching Grade 4
Qualifications and Requirements
  • have a valid Alberta Teaching Certificate
  • have successful elementary school teaching experience
  • have effective organizational and classroom management skills
  • have classroom practice that is focused on:
  • a student-centered approach to responsive instruction that ensures student engagement and understanding and nurtures teacher–student relationships
  • the application of a variety of technologies to support learning for all students
  • assessment for / of learning that will support students in their areas of needed growth and achievement
  • the domains of the NGPS Quality Learning Environment (QLE)
  • collegial collaboration support and intervention
  • diversity and broadening students knowledge of First Nation Metis and Inuit
  • strong and effective communication with parents and the community
  • have school practice that is focused on:
  • working with school administration to support the School Action Plan
  • a commitment to student achievement and success through collaborative response
  • working with school administration team to enhance staff wellness and team development and spirit
  • outstanding communication and interpersonal skills
Start Date

Duties will begin August 27, 2025 – December 19, 2025
